Skip to main content

Discretization tools for finite volume and inverse problems

Project description

Latest PyPI version MIT license Travis CI build status Coverage status codacy status Code issues

discretize - A python package for finite volume discretization.

The vision is to create a package for finite volume simulation with a focus on large scale inverse problems. This package has the following features:

  • modular with respect to the spacial discretization

  • built with the inverse problem in mind

  • supports 1D, 2D and 3D problems

  • access to sparse matrix operators

  • access to derivatives to mesh variables

Citing discretize

Please cite the SimPEG paper when using discretize in your work:

Cockett, R., Kang, S., Heagy, L. J., Pidlisecky, A., & Oldenburg, D. W. (2015). SimPEG: An open source framework for simulation and gradient based parameter estimation in geophysical applications. Computers & Geosciences.

BibTex:

@article{cockett2015simpeg,
  title={SimPEG: An open source framework for simulation and gradient based parameter estimation in geophysical applications},
  author={Cockett, Rowan and Kang, Seogi and Heagy, Lindsey J and Pidlisecky, Adam and Oldenburg, Douglas W},
  journal={Computers \& Geosciences},
  year={2015},
  publisher={Elsevier}
}

Project details


Release history Release notifications | RSS feed

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

discretize-0.1.6.tar.gz (194.3 kB view details)

Uploaded Source

Built Distributions

discretize-0.1.6-py3.6-win32.egg (241.7 kB view details)

Uploaded Source

discretize-0.1.6-py3.5-win32.egg (245.9 kB view details)

Uploaded Source

discretize-0.1.6-py2.7-win32.egg (243.8 kB view details)

Uploaded Source

discretize-0.1.6-cp36-cp36m-win32.whl (139.3 kB view details)

Uploaded CPython 3.6m Windows x86

discretize-0.1.6-cp35-cp35m-win32.whl (140.0 kB view details)

Uploaded CPython 3.5m Windows x86

discretize-0.1.6-cp27-cp27m-win32.whl (142.4 kB view details)

Uploaded CPython 2.7m Windows x86

File details

Details for the file discretize-0.1.6.tar.gz.

File metadata

  • Download URL: discretize-0.1.6.tar.gz
  • Upload date:
  • Size: 194.3 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No

File hashes

Hashes for discretize-0.1.6.tar.gz
Algorithm Hash digest
SHA256 e67db6bec9a4b79adf210a5636a44bdd63204b0bcd2e5eca69b54223658b724b
MD5 72943b50b6dc8265725fece92cf43bbf
BLAKE2b-256 e3484e4c736c464d7ec8fd71a24f8123c67444d2ceffd88f022a37dd1da1741e

See more details on using hashes here.

Provenance

File details

Details for the file discretize-0.1.6-py3.6-win32.egg.

File metadata

File hashes

Hashes for discretize-0.1.6-py3.6-win32.egg
Algorithm Hash digest
SHA256 88167092a4379a9f0c520a77dc524f66f20099ace52beb23fce5620eebb3f673
MD5 abef35e9ed0981a5f95350c70aedf68b
BLAKE2b-256 a25bde34aeb66ad0a062e853fe9c7ba0f92506d4ff27ef319520058c2b30e636

See more details on using hashes here.

Provenance

File details

Details for the file discretize-0.1.6-py3.5-win32.egg.

File metadata

File hashes

Hashes for discretize-0.1.6-py3.5-win32.egg
Algorithm Hash digest
SHA256 ec68272452775e746dcc96945f8daf26b72c5f4df204d7ccde1c9ea4c6c9f43a
MD5 e051e3e354f5ca3cac775cb2bea78f87
BLAKE2b-256 3b9104553e1667ccd88820f34d9d7e7a62c2c7878c7ae2c9b1b40b31ae903fad

See more details on using hashes here.

Provenance

File details

Details for the file discretize-0.1.6-py2.7-win32.egg.

File metadata

File hashes

Hashes for discretize-0.1.6-py2.7-win32.egg
Algorithm Hash digest
SHA256 d787d3a99ee7fcbee173da5791abff487729e708e4ff6f3a050b81c47d3d22d1
MD5 e6626583e3e738783303ab3615aee878
BLAKE2b-256 fdd63ef84a733eb49d596285309d374d143f33fce5967dac4edf91c760803a16

See more details on using hashes here.

Provenance

File details

Details for the file discretize-0.1.6-cp36-cp36m-win32.whl.

File metadata

File hashes

Hashes for discretize-0.1.6-cp36-cp36m-win32.whl
Algorithm Hash digest
SHA256 f5fd3dfcb007559c5fbca302db36cff3ce34227f04d9f89cade1977438d97ad2
MD5 68f9501fd5be1bdde3eab5ac54782be5
BLAKE2b-256 f356f5d489089a45e6ca639ac4754987e5bd8959991ea36d3a9fc1f90f44cc66

See more details on using hashes here.

Provenance

File details

Details for the file discretize-0.1.6-cp35-cp35m-win32.whl.

File metadata

File hashes

Hashes for discretize-0.1.6-cp35-cp35m-win32.whl
Algorithm Hash digest
SHA256 2b7eba9330b42d5b42a8e6eda59efcc0c419b48a5ceab401b6358b47a6bf0f13
MD5 93c15e4d972a4ef00c2d856540011623
BLAKE2b-256 d6868caa1b30465533e705bd89a68e49c1c0804416f5c8be12705e8d3ca8d0bc

See more details on using hashes here.

Provenance

File details

Details for the file discretize-0.1.6-cp27-cp27m-win32.whl.

File metadata

File hashes

Hashes for discretize-0.1.6-cp27-cp27m-win32.whl
Algorithm Hash digest
SHA256 0182e467567bbe49d2195d88152fa94e40977310578490ead66ecf0f19206809
MD5 4112afde3a38b8188633b9551fcf6dda
BLAKE2b-256 6fa5d5a931092dd800439d76018e071570b05ad58e2fb3c8a558e27cf240bebd

See more details on using hashes here.

Provenance

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page